Investigation Launched Against Barclays PLC: What Does It Mean for Investors and the World?

On February 13, 2025, Barclays PLC (NASDAQ:BCS) disclosed in its annual report for 2024 that the U.K.’s Financial Conduct Authority (FCA) was investigating the company’s U.K. division for potential lapses in financial controls and possible violations of anti-money laundering laws. This announcement came as a surprise to investors and raised concerns about the health and integrity of Barclays’ operations.

Impact on Barclays PLC and Its Investors

The FCA’s investigation is focused on Barclays’ U.K. division, which is a significant part of the company’s overall business. The potential violations of financial controls and anti-money laundering laws could result in hefty fines, reputational damage, and legal costs for Barclays. Moreover, the investigation may lead to regulatory action against individual executives, further increasing the financial and reputational risk for the company.

Investors have reacted negatively to the news, with Barclays’ stock price dropping significantly following the announcement. The uncertainty surrounding the outcome of the investigation and the potential financial and reputational consequences for the company have caused some investors to sell off their holdings in Barclays. This selling pressure could put downward pressure on the company’s stock price in the short term.
